前端知识每日总结

前端知识每日总结_第1张图片
认真对待每一天

每日必背单词

|1.uninstall 卸载; | 2.setup 设置; | 3.paste 张贴|4.exit 退出;|
| ------------- | :-------------: | -----: |
| 5.monitor 监视器 |6.keyboard 键盘;|7.install 安装;|8.cut 剪切;|
|9.copy 拷贝; |||10.edit 编辑;|

gitbub 命令行

1.把项目档下来 git clone 项目网址;
2.打开下载下来的文件夹,把要上传的项目拖进来
3.用 git add . 上传
4.用 git status 检测能不能上传
5.用 git commit - m"说明"
6.用 git push 上传


this问题

  1. 定时器中不能使用this
  1. 行间不能用this
    3.事件套用函数时不能用this
    4.attachEvent不能用this

for循环 i问题

  1. 循环中加计时器
  1. 循环中加事件

css兼容2

  1. 换行或空格产生的兼容问题

概念:在两个input标签,或者input与span标签之间,会产生多余3个像素空格的问题
原理:在ff,chrome当中(在IE上会屏蔽掉)会将代码中的换行或空格解析为==空文本节点==
解决方法:
1.不换行;
2.设置父级块的大小为0;
3.设置margin-left为-3像素


2.margin-top值叠加问题

概念:两个或多个毗邻的普通流中的块元素垂直方向上的 margin 会折叠
解决方法:
1、修改父元素的高度,增加padding-top样式模拟
(padding-top:1px;常用)
2、为父元素添加overflow:hidden;样式即可(完美)
3、为父元素或者子元素声明浮动(float:left;可用)
4、为父元素添加border(border:1px solid transparent;可用)
5、为父元素或者子元素声明绝对定位


3.掌握针对IE6浏览器的标准

透明rgba与opacity
使用IE6当中的滤镜filter替代掉,如:opacity:0.6;filter:alpha(opacity=60)。
table标签当中border-color属性设置无效
运用CSS样式进行控制,而不是使用属性进行样式的处理。a标签hover不适用于所有标签
png格式图片
使用javascript进行处理;或者使用gif、jpg图像替代掉png图片的使用。

你可能感兴趣的:(前端知识每日总结)